Watch Ariana Grande and John Legend's Magical Music Video for 'Beauty and the Beast'

Disney has finally released a new music video for Ariana Grande and John Legend's duet "Beauty and the Beast", the theme song of Disney's upcoming fairytale retelling "Beauty and the Beast (2017)" which is led by Emma Watson and Dan Stevens. Featuring some scenes from the live-action flick, the new visuals features Legend playing the piano inside a glamorous ballroom.

Directed by Dave Mayer, the clip sets off with Grande singing her verse as she is joined by red-clad dancers who wear matching veils. The 23-year-old songstress looks stunning in a rose-colored gown while she lets her hair down. Legend, meawhile, looks dapper in a blue-and-gold suit.

Grande is currently embarking on her "Dangerous Woman" tour, where she had an unwelcome guest onstage during her tour stop in Philadelphia. Her performance was interrupted by a creepy male fan who trespassed the security guards and made his way to the stage. Even though she was shocked, the "Side to Side" hitmaker calmly asked her security guards to be "careful and gentle" with the fan.

Meanwhile, Legend is gearing up to kick off his "Darkness and Light" North American tour. The extensive tour will begin on May 12 at Miamis's Bayfront Park Amphitheater and wrap up at New Orleans' ESSENCE Festival on June 30. Joined by singer/songwriter Gallant, the trek will include stops in some big cities including Nashville, Los Angeles and Atlanta among others.
